Oscar De La Hoya had a highly successful boxing career that spanned from the early 1990s to 2008. He won numerous world titles in multiple weight divisions and became one of the highest-earning boxers of his time. Over the course of his career, he earned tens of millions of dollars from prize money and pay-per-view fights. - Promotional Business:
De La Hoya founded Golden Boy Promotions, one of the most prominent boxing promotional companies in the world. Through this business, he promoted many successful boxing events and represented several high-profile fighters. The success of Golden Boy Promotions contributed significantly to his net worth. - Endorsements:
